SEOUL/BEIJING (Reuters) - Mystery surrounded the destination of North Korea's Kim Jong-il on Wednesday, a day after media reports that the secretive communist leader had entered China on board his armoured train.
One source in Beijing had said Kim was on his way to Russia.
